Course Curriculum

Module 1: Introduction to Solar Power Technologies

  • Renewable energy overview

  • Solar energy fundamentals

  • Global and Indian solar power scenario

  • Types of solar power plants


Module 2: Solar PV System Components

  • Solar panels and PV modules

  • Inverters and charge controllers

  • Batteries and energy storage basics

  • Cables, junction boxes, connectors

  • Mounting structures


Module 3: Solar Power Plant Types

  • Rooftop solar systems

  • Utility-scale solar power plants

  • Grid-connected systems

  • Off-grid and hybrid systems


Module 4: Electrical Systems in Solar Power Plants

  • DC and AC electrical systems

  • Inverter selection and configuration

  • Transformers and switchgear

  • Earthing and lightning protection

  • Protection systems and safety


Module 5: Mechanical & Civil Aspects

  • Module mounting structures

  • Foundation types

  • Structural considerations

  • Layout planning and spacing

  • Wind and load considerations


Module 6: Installation & Commissioning

  • Installation sequence and best practices

  • Electrical connections and testing

  • Commissioning procedures

  • Performance ratio basics


Module 7: Operations & Maintenance (O&M)

  • Preventive and corrective maintenance

  • Fault identification and troubleshooting

  • Cleaning and inspection practices

  • Performance monitoring


Module 8: Safety & Standards

  • Electrical safety practices

  • Working at height safety

  • Fire safety in solar plants

  • Codes and standards overview


Module 9: Solar Project Execution & Documentation

  • Project lifecycle understanding

  • Site coordination

  • Basic project documentation

  • Quality control practices
